Frequently Asked Questions For StringKing Youth Bats

When selecting a youth bat, consider factors such as the bat's weight, length, and material. The right combination can significantly impact a player's performance and comfort. Additionally, it's important to check the bat's certification to ensure it meets league requirements.

Youth bats are typically made from aluminum, composite, or a combination of both materials. Aluminum bats are known for their durability and performance, while composite bats often provide a larger sweet spot and better feel. Understanding the material can help you choose a bat that suits your playing style.

Bat weight plays a crucial role in a player's swing speed and control. Lighter bats can help younger players generate faster swings, while heavier bats may provide more power. It's essential to find a balance that allows for both speed and control to enhance overall performance.

USSSA and USA certifications indicate different standards for youth bats. USSSA bats are typically designed for travel ball and may have different performance characteristics compared to USA bats, which are used in Little League and other youth leagues. Understanding these differences can help ensure compliance with league rules.

The ideal bat length for youth players generally depends on their height and weight. A common guideline is to choose a bat that reaches the player's waist when standing upright. This ensures that the bat is manageable and allows for better control during swings.

To determine the right bat size, consider measuring your child's height and weight, as well as their skill level. Many brands provide sizing charts that can guide you in selecting the appropriate length and weight. It's also helpful to have your child try out different bats to see what feels most comfortable.
